Transaction 7c508569110e27e2d3becf6a1b4a531b22f1d9a32b1ea1817d02ce47efde73b5

3 Input
1 Outputs
  • 7c508569110e27e2d3becf6a1b4a531b22f1d9a32b1ea1817d02ce47efde73b5:0
  • value  1040000
    address  bc1qtfg7ar63yf46h3ml9q0tk0un5nattrqxmrtr2x